Focus on fulfilling the right to truth.
Truth-seeking bodies such as truth commissions, commissions of inquiry, fact-finding, and mapping inquiries are focused on fulfilling the right to truth. They undertake investigations into past serious violations of international human rights and humanitarian law to ensure the victims and their families' right to know the causes and conditions of the violations and the reasons leading to their victimization. They also have the right to know the truth about the identity of the perpetrators and the fate and whereabouts of victims in the event of enforced disappearances . The Regional human rights bodies have also underscored the collective nature of this right, i.e. the right of the entirety of society to know the truth about past events, as well as the motives and circumstances in which the atrocities were committed in order to prevent the recurrence of such acts in the future .
